What is the goal of using analytics in digital marketing?

Explanation:
Using analytics in digital marketing primarily focuses on gathering data about customer interactions to understand their behaviors, preferences, and engagement with content. This data helps marketers identify what strategies are working effectively and what areas require improvement. By analyzing customer data, marketers can optimize campaigns, refine targeting, tailor content to meet the audience's needs, and ultimately enhance the overall effectiveness of their marketing efforts. This data-driven approach ensures that decisions made are based on tangible evidence rather than assumptions, leading to improved results and return on investment.
